The Strategic Imperative of Early Talent Mapping

Leadership transitions can make or break an organisation's trajectory. A single exceptional leader can catalyse innovation, drive strategic transformation, and create sustainable competitive advantage. Conversely, a leadership vacuum or poorly timed recruitment can disrupt organisational momentum and erode stakeholder confidence.

The most forward-thinking companies recognise that talent mapping is not a singular event, but a continuous, dynamic process. It's about creating a comprehensive ecosystem of potential leadership talent that aligns with your organisation's strategic vision, cultural values, and future aspirations.

The Multidimensional Benefits of Proactive Talent Mapping

Effective talent mapping transcends the immediate goal of filling a leadership position. It's a strategic investment that offers multifaceted benefits:

Long Term Relationship Building

By engaging with potential leaders early, you create a pipeline of relationships rather than transactional interactions. This approach allows for:

  • Deeper understanding of candidate potential
  • Gradual alignment of organisational and individual aspirations
  • More informed and nuanced recruitment decisions

Risk Mitigation

Unexpected leadership transitions can be potentially destabilising. Proactive talent mapping helps:

  • Reduce time to hire pressures
  • Minimise productivity disruptions
  • Ensure continuity of strategic vision
  • Maintain organisational resilience

Strategic Alignment

Talent mapping enables organisations to:

  • Anticipate future leadership needs
  • Identify skill gaps
  • Develop targeted development strategies
  • Ensure leadership talent aligns with evolving business strategies
